"NHS 5 day weeks with a backlog?"

About: Kibworth Health Centre

(as a service user),

As someone accustomed to working until the work is done,   I find the current NHS medical centre 5d week office hours approach quite unsatisfactory.    

As a result I am unable to arrane a consultation with a doctor .The centre is closed to visitors except by appointment. Appointments can only be made by telephoning & the most frequent result of that is to be told that there are no appointments today and to try again to-morrow.

 I telephoned needing medical advice.   I joined a queue of 50 people at about 0801h, when the lines had opened. I spent 40 minutes waiting to be told just that & that no appointments were available before August. Full stop. Booking online proved impossible as NO appointments, regardless of date, were available via online booking.   

Is the NHS really is such crisis that this situation is nationwide?   And, from a purely managerial view, WHY are practice hours so restricted when such a backlog exists?  Are there no staff at all available?  Or is it no money to pay them?
